Background: Many reports have demonstrated SEN virus (SEN-V) infection rates in hemodialysis patients, but the SEN-V infection rate in peritoneal dialysis (PD) patients … Web6. apr 2024 · It can be performed either manually as in continuous ambulatory peritoneal dialysis (CAPD) or using mechanical devices as in automated PD (APD). In CAPD, the patient or caregiver must perform at least 3 to 5 exchanges every day; while in APD, the dialysate exchange is by a PD machine working at night for 8–10 hours during sleep time …

One study reported a higher risk of loss of RKF in the first year of APD compared with CAPD , but this may be influenced by selection bias, since older and sicker patients were treated with APD. Web20. aug 2024 · The current clinical evidence comparing outcomes between continuous ambulatory peritoneal dialysis (CAPD) and automated peritoneal dialysis (APD) is of low grade and is largely based on observational studies that are limited by confounding and bias and may not always be relevant to the NHS population.

WebBased on theoretical considerations and little evidence, TPD could provide better clearances than conventional APD when a very high dialysate flow (≥5 l/h) is used. Such dialysate flow rates are not routinely prescribed in home APD patients.
